From Logo to Loyalty: Building a Cohesive Brand in the Bay Area

 

Building a strong brand in the Bay Area isn’t just about having a nice logo. It’s about crafting a consistent experience—from your visual identity to your messaging—that resonates with your local audience. In a region known for innovation and creativity, brand cohesion can mean the difference between being remembered or forgotten.

Why Cohesive Branding Matters

Your brand is more than a logo—it’s the perception customers form about your business across every touchpoint. Cohesive branding builds recognition, trust, and loyalty. Local businesses need a brand that aligns with the values, culture, and expectations of a diverse, innovation-driven audience.

Step 1: Design a Logo That Reflects Local Identity

Your logo is the visual cornerstone of your brand. To stand out in such a diverse and design-forward market, your logo should be:

      • Simple but distinct

      • Culturally relevant

      • Adaptable across digital and physical platforms

    Think of brands like Airbnb or Slack—both born in the Bay—whose logos reflect clarity and personality while remaining versatile.

    Step 2: Create a Consistent Brand Voice

    What you say matters, but how you say it is just as critical. Your brand voice should reflect your values and resonate with your target customer. Is your tone playful, authoritative, inclusive, or disruptive? Make it consistent across:

        • Website copy

        • Social media

        • Email marketing

        • Customer service scripts

      For Bay Area creatives and tech-savvy audiences, authenticity and clarity go a long way.

      Step 3: Align Visual Elements Across Platforms

      Color schemes, typography, photo styles, and layouts must work together across platforms. Your website, business cards, packaging, and social feeds should feel like parts of a single ecosystem. Consistency reinforces your credibility and makes your brand instantly recognizable.

      Step 4: Connect Through Localized Content

      Brand loyalty grows when customers feel connected to your mission and community presence. Consider:

          • Sharing behind-the-scenes stories from your local roots

          • Highlighting local partnerships

          • Posting location-based testimonials or case studies

        This hyperlocal approach not only strengthens your brand identity but also boosts local SEO.

        Step 5: From Awareness to Loyalty

        Once your visual and verbal branding is aligned, it’s time to build lasting relationships:

            • Offer value in your content (educational blogs, videos, or guides)

            • Collect and showcase local testimonials and user-generated content

            • Stay present through consistent touchpoints—email newsletters, follow-ups, and thank-yous

          Customers don’t just want to buy—they want to belong. When your brand feels trustworthy, local, and aligned with their values, loyalty follows.

          Final Thoughts

          Cohesive branding is a strategic advantage—especially in a crowded, creative market like the Bay Area. By aligning your logo, messaging, and customer experience, you create a brand that not only stands out, but sticks around.
